A filter is a word we use in MS Excel often to see only a specific set of data. Filters at Dataset Level in SSRS - Tutorial Gateway The LIKE operator in SQL can be used along SELECT, UPDATE, WHERE, or DELETE statements, etc. Second tablix should have everything which is not appearing in Tablix1 . Lets now place a Chart on the drawing area using the Toolbox. The dialogue window Select Chart Type displays. Copyright (c) 2006-2023 Edgewood Solutions, LLC All rights reserved Expressions are constructed in Microsoft Visual Basic and start with an equal sign (=). There are two common methods: using the NULL check box, and using a wildcard character. A few users only see five columns, others would like to see ten fields, and others would like to see 20 fields. ALL RIGHTS RESERVED. However sometimes, A smart classroom isan EdTech-upgraded classroom that enhances the teaching and learning process for both the teachers and the students by inculcating audio, video, animations, images, multimedia etc. Is this even possible to have "%blah" or "blah%" filters in report builder? By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Yamaha Snowmobile Serial Number Lookup, Choose Well after adding the expression to the text editor. by "_". Wildcard characters are used with the SQL LIKE operator. WHERE Table1.Name = LIKE '%'@Name'%'. Using wildcard in report Filters in Reporting | Telerik Forums We can create a list of catalog numbers with the wildcards described above to make our search more flexible: The Lot Number, Serial Number, Batch Number parameters can be left blank or values can be entered to further refine the search. Click Filters. Progress is the leading provider of application development and digital experience technologies. In Expression, type or select the expression for the field to filter. Now, the parameter is setup to accept multiple values. All we have to do However there is a workaround that we can apply to implement the functionality in SSRS. Solution: Create a Report Parameter with the values representing the names of all the dataset fields. Add a Filter (Report Builder and SSRS), More info about Internet Explorer and Microsoft Edge, Filter Equation Examples (Report Builder and SSRS), Add Dataset Filters, Data Region Filters, and Group Filters (Report Builder and SSRS), Expression Examples (Report Builder and SSRS). Filtering on aggregate values for a dataset is not supported. 4.CByte(string) Converts the input supplied to Byte. Fortunately, SSRS allows us to include comments in our expressions. For examples of filter equations, see Filter Equation Examples (Report Builder and SSRS). Bissell 2513e Vs 1400j, On the Home tab, in the Shared Datasets group, click Datasets. Bulk update symbol size units from mm to map units in rule-based symbology. Linear Algebra - Linear transformation question. 23 years of excellence in Home Tuition. Using Count with Like and Wildcard in SSRS Expression. This increases the engagement factor and leads to better-performing students. This is just a simplified version of what we actually did, allowing only "?" SSRS Filter not working as expected I have a working report that generates a list of orders and filters based on parameters for year and month. An expression could be used to set multiple report item characteristics. However, when add the name para nothing returns. real clue we get is that the error appears near a comma. order. Expressions are written in Microsoft Visual Basic, and can use built-in functions, custom code, report and group variables, and user-defined variables. the report and the underlying query. This method follows very similar to the previous method, but is worth noting To edit the expression, click the expression (fx) button. To add a filter, you must specify one or more conditions that are filter equations. This is a migrated thread and some comments may be shown as answers. Note that by allowing blanks in the report a value is passed in even if its empty (). SQL Server Reporting Services has a powerful feature called expressions (SSRS). Parameters in SSRS - SqlSkull As to your question, I'm not sure exactly what SSRS passes to that parameter. I get errors when I try to use SQL-like wildcards such as '%'. THANKS! expression to exclude the following names from my report, but there isn't a Not Like operator: Expression: PtLastName Constants, modifiers, connections to built-in values (fields, collections, and functions), and outside or customized code can be used in the expression. A filter equation consists of an expression that identifies the data that you want to filter, an operator, and the value to compare to. Login details for this Free course will be emailed to you. 1. The two filters have invalid value expressions. From the list box, select the data type that matches the type of data in the expression you created in step 5. tries to specify multiple Order numbers, rather than a single Order. The data types of the filtered data and the value must match. SSRS Wildcard search in Report Parameters - Stack Overflow Visit Microsoft Q&A to post new questions. Wildcard strings are similar to normal strings but with two characters that have special meaning. The Like operator expects a string to compare to that uses an * as a wildcard for any character (s). Add a Filter to a Dataset (Report Builder and SSRS) By: Kenneth Krehbiel | Updated: 2018-06-14 | Comments (2) | Related: > Reporting Services Development. Returns an array containing the grouped fields values. The average value of the aggregated field is returned. "You will find a fortune, though it will not be the one you seek." SQL SERVER REPORTING SERVICES Parameters allows the users to control the report data, it filters the report dataset based on value provided to parameter using a text box. With the ability to arrange the display of parameters in the newer versions of SQL data tools, we can provide some hints for the user about using wildcards. How do I write an SSRS Wildcard search in the Report Parameters, SELECT * Please help as soon as possible. Our sample report captures surgical implants/explants from the Meditech Client Server scheduling tables. SSRS training - Parameters - Wildcards - YouTube Ask your own question & get feedback from real experts. SQL Server Reporting Services, Power View. order, multi order, and wildcard entry: I'm glad you found the tip useful. with throughout this tip: The first and more common method is to allow null values for the parameter in Animal Jam Ultra Rare Spiked Collar, The scope of a table cell is determined by row and column group memberships. That is why we are getting a comma error, because the list is and "*" to be used as wildcards, but it works fine for our users. Expressions provide more flexibility over a reports content, design, and interaction. 500mg Test A Week, Use the format string2 to format string1. Expressions begin with an equal sign (=). How do you ensure that a red herring doesn't violate Chekhov's gun? the case as SSRS error messages follow quickly when either method is attempted. I get errors when I try to use SQL-like wildcards such as '%'. Just concatenate the wildcards directly to the parameter string. You may also have a look at the following articles to learn more . For example, the wildcard string B?b will cause matches with Bob, Brb, and Bbb, but not Bbab, because only one character is used to match with the ?. SSRS, Step-1: We establish a new Reporting Services project in Visual Studio 2015 or SQL Server Data Tools 2010 or higher. As discussed in earlier articles, we give our Shared data source a name and set the connection string. ssrs filter expression wildcard - Visaonlinevietnam.org Solved: SSRS: wildcard filter tablix | Experts Exchange Have you tried using the wildcard character * as in *blah or blah*? Execute Sql statement and send result to email. Using wildcard characters makes the LIKE operator more flexible than using the = and != string comparison operators. Adresse:Calea Grivitei, 2-2A, 1st District, Bucharest, 2020 FABIZ - Bucharest University of Economic Studies, Master in Entrepreneurship and Business Administration (MEBA), Master en Entrepreneuriat et Gestion des Affaires (MEGA), Master in Entrepreneurship und Betriebswirtschaft (MEBW), Master in Digital Business and Innovation (MDBI), International Master in Business Administration (IMBA), Master of Entrepreneurship and Business Administration in Energy (Energy MBA). Our sample report uses several free text parameters that can leverage wildcards. Thanks! ssrs filter expression wildcard ------------------------------------------------------------. =Split(Code.RemoveDuplicates(join(Parameters!Hidden_Param.Value,~)),,) Step 6 : Use this Main parameter in your main dataset , Dataset propertiesparameter to map it. I am already aware of the "Contains" operator and how it is equivalent to %BLAH%. The parameters on lines 6 and 7 provide some hints for the user. It looks I need to tweak the code in like operator to get only the records that has city like below. Asking for help, clarification, or responding to other answers. Kenneth, thank you for sharing this! Batch split images vertically in half, sequentially numbering the output files. FROM Table1 Open a shared dataset in shared dataset mode. By using LIKE in the query or stored procedure called by an SSRS report, we allow the report user to leverage SQL wildcards to improve the results of the report. SQL Wildcard Characters. What am I doing wrong here in the PlotLegends specification? It returns "2" everytime, no matter what the criteria is in the Like. Note: with the Tablix filters, I can add Expression Code, operator <> then . 25.5K subscribers This is a training video covering the below topic in SQL Server Reporting Services (SSRS). I am trying to use a wildcard in a Filter condition within a SSRS - Report Builder report. ssrs filter expression wildcard - MEBW formId: '8cd24a42-8f18-4182-968c-08c82be76999' Hi, So Im getting there with SSRS and doing the majority ofthe work as an SQL view and then adding that view to the report. More information on using wildcards and the LIKE predicate can be found at LIKE (Transact-SQL). Is there a solution to add special characters from software and how to do it. Multi-line comments arent even considered. Wildcard Characters : % and _ SQL wildcards must be used with SQL LIKE operator. In a SQL query we can use LIKE and wildcards to try to work around these issues. This method is quickly determined unusable due to a restriction within SSRS. Now, if the parameter has available values supplied, this poses no issue as there is a 'Select All' feature for this exact purpose. out of place. Typos, transposed characters and even data entry into the wrong field present a challenge when trying to report on the data. The solution is to select a wildcard character like * or Ask us anything. A column in the report can be referred to using everyday words. is a Select All feature for this exact purpose. MEDITECH Data Repository, Expressions are used frequently in paginated reports to control content and report appearance. Report Writing Services, A preview of the report is given here: We can enter a value into a text box without using TextBoxs expressions, fields, or parameters. Some names and products listed are the registered trademarks of their respective owners. The report builder is for businerss users where the users may not have the SQL knowledge. A new blank filter equation appears. See screenshots: Two important things to note: The underscore matches only one character, so the results in the above query will only return 3-letter names, not a name such as 'John'; The underscore matches at least one character, so the results do not include 'Jo'; Try running the previous query using % instead of _ to see the difference.. NOT LIKE. The key to this method is the latter part of the WHERE clause where we check
Did Lagos State Declared Holiday Tomorrow, Delaware County, Ohio Obituaries, Darren Leader And Rob Riggle Friendship, Microlissencephaly Life Expectancy, Articles S